A Kabbalat Shabbat Study - Service
Kabbalat Shabbat was introduced by the mystics of Safed, themselves refugees from Spain. In time, these prayers spread and were adopted throughout the Jewish world. |

A native of St. Petersburg and Germany, Jascha Nemtsov is a highly decorated solo pianist and chamber musician. He is dedicated to romantic and modern music, and especially to works of Jewish composers who were persecuted by the Nazis. Bask in beauty of a true master giving tribute to an almost forgotten school of music. |
